What to Expect
Working in security in Heeze-Leende generally involves shifts that can cover days, evenings, weekends, or nights. Typical working hours range from 8 to 12 hours per shift, depending on the employer. The physical demands include spending long periods standing, patrolling, and sometimes controlling access points or operating surveillance equipment. The work environment can be quiet, with moments of high alert during incidents or emergencies. It is important to stay attentive, alert, and professional at all times. Employers in the Netherlands often emphasize teamwork, and you will be expected to follow strict safety protocols and procedures. Good physical condition and the ability to handle stressful situations are essential.
Requirements
Most security jobs in the Netherlands require candidates to be at least 21 years old. A clean criminal record and valid identification are necessary, along with the right to work in the Netherlands. While previous security experience can be helpful, many employers also offer training for new workers. Common documents needed include a residence permit, a BSN number (social security number), and potentially a security certificate or license depending on the role. Familiarity with Dutch work regulations ensures you know your rights related to working hours, breaks, and wages.
Salary & Benefits
In 2026, the minimum hourly wage for security workers over 21 is at least €14.71. Many security roles pay between €14.71 to €18.00 per hour, depending on experience and shift timing. Full-time roles often offer between €2,500 to €3,200 gross monthly salary. Benefits may include paid holidays, health insurance contributions, and participation in the collective labor agreement (CAO), which sets minimum standards for pay and working conditions. Working in security also offers room for advancement, such as supervisory roles, which come with higher wages and additional responsibilities.
